Road cycling around Fenegrò, located in Lombardy, Italy, offers diverse landscapes characterized by green environments, river valleys, and natural parks. The region features a network of routes, including the Olona Valley Cycle Path, which repurposes a former railway line and provides both asphalt and dirt sections. Cyclists can explore areas near the Olona River, as well as natural spaces like Parco delle Groane e della Brughiera Briantea, Lura Park, and Pineta Park. The climb to Alpe del Viceré from Albavilla is a classic ascent of the Larian Triangle. It measures about 5.4 km with an elevation gain of 465 meters and an average gradient of 8.5%. It features challenging sections with gradients up to 12%, followed by more rideable sections before the finish. Route details Start: Albavilla Centre (approx. 430 m a.s.l.). Finish: Alpe del Viceré Park (903 m a.s.l.). Average gradient: 8.5%. Maximum gradient: Approx. 12% (located around the 3rd kilometer).

The Valle Olona offers a cycle and pedestrian path of about 50 km that develops mainly on flat ground along the river. However, for those who love a challenge, the surrounding hills offer climbs and descents with challenging gradients of up to 10%.

Parco Rile Tenore Olona (RTO), located between the provinces of Varese and Como, is famous for its dense network of woodland paths, vicinal roads, and historic winding connections that skirt the streams and climb the terraces of the Olona Valley. Among the most iconic road sections and routes that fit this description, the renowned "Piccolo Stelvio" in Gornate Olona stands out, an asphalted road within the park known to all cyclists for its close hairpin bends that recall the famous alpine pass in miniature.

Montorfano is a small village named after the mountain that overlooks it, a limestone outcrop so named because it rises isolated from the pre-Alpine mountain range behind it. Legend has it that the tears of the mountain, shed for its solitude, gave rise to a body of water, Lake Montorfano, one of the smaller lakes in Brianza.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many traffic-free road cycling routes are available around Fenegrò?

There are over 20 traffic-free road cycling routes around Fenegrò, offering a variety of distances and difficulty levels to explore the region's quiet roads and dedicated cycle paths.

What kind of terrain can I expect on traffic-free road cycling routes near Fenegrò?

Many routes utilize the Olona Valley Cycle Path, which repurposes a former railway line. This path offers a mix of asphalt and dirt sections, providing varied terrain. While primarily focused on road cycling, some routes might include well-maintained unpaved segments, especially within the parks.

Are there any easy, traffic-free road cycling routes suitable for beginners or families?

Yes, Fenegrò offers several easy, traffic-free road cycling routes perfect for beginners or families. For example, the Asnago-Cermenate climb – Cucciago Climb loop from Saronno is an easy option. The Olona Valley Cycle Path itself is also generally accessible and suitable for varying skill levels.

Can I find challenging traffic-free road cycling routes with significant climbs?

While many traffic-free routes focus on gentler gradients, some routes in the broader area around Fenegrò do offer more significant elevation gains. For a more challenging ride, consider the Vineyard Pathway in Ticino – Bellavista – Monte Generoso loop from Fino Mornasco, which includes substantial climbing.

What natural attractions can I see along the traffic-free cycling routes?

The routes often pass through or near beautiful natural areas. You can explore the Lura Park, the Bosco del Proverbio Pine Forest, and the picturesque Ca' Bianca Pond within Pineta Park, known for its water lilies and aquatic wildlife. The Olona River itself is a central natural feature of the region.

Are there historical or cultural landmarks to visit on these routes?

Yes, the cycling routes in the Fenegrò area are rich with history. Along the Olona Valley Cycle Path, you can encounter ancient industrial factories and visit significant cultural sites like the Monastero di Torba and the Collegiata di Castiglione Olona. Fenegrò itself also offers local heritage sites such as Chiesa Santa Maria Nascente.

Are there any circular traffic-free road cycling routes around Fenegrò?

Many of the routes are designed as loops, allowing you to start and end at the same point. Examples include the Steep Path and Dirt Track – Bergoro Climb loop from Gerenzano-Turate and the Saronno Cathedral – Limido Comasco loop from Saronno.

What do other cyclists say about the traffic-free road cycling experience in Fenegrò?

The area is highly rated by the komoot community, with an average score of 4.2 stars. Reviewers often praise the tranquility of the routes, the scenic natural environments, and the opportunity to explore historical sites away from vehicle traffic.

Is it possible to access these routes using public transport with a bike?

Fenegrò is located in a well-connected region. While specific public transport options for bikes can vary, many regional train lines in Lombardy allow bikes, providing access to towns near the starting points of these routes. It's advisable to check local transport schedules and bike policies in advance.

Are there options for parking near the starting points of these routes?

Yes, many towns and parks in the Fenegrò area, especially those serving as common starting points for cycle routes, offer designated parking facilities. Look for parking near major trailheads or in the centers of towns like Saronno or Tradate, which are often departure points for komoot tours.

What is the best time of year to enjoy traffic-free road cycling in Fenegrò?

Spring and autumn generally offer the most pleasant conditions for road cycling in Fenegrò, with mild temperatures and beautiful scenery. Summer can be enjoyable, but it's best to start early to avoid the midday heat. Winter cycling is possible, but be prepared for cooler temperatures and potentially wet conditions.

Are there any specific long-distance traffic-free cycle paths I should know about?

The Olona Valley Cycle Path is a significant long-distance route that forms part of the larger Olona-Lura cycle path network. This path allows for extensive car-free cycling, connecting various towns, parks, and historical trails across several Lombardy provinces.

Where can I find a scenic traffic-free route with good viewpoints?

Routes that follow the Olona Valley often provide scenic views of the river and surrounding green landscapes. The section of the Olona Valley Cycle Path near the Gurone Dam, with its almost 12% gradient along embankments, offers a unique cycling experience and elevated perspectives of the area.
